Passenger Caught Smoking in Singapore Airlines Lavatory

A passenger on Singapore Airlines flight #SQ836 from Singapore to Shanghai was caught smoking in the aircraft lavatory during the flight. On August 21, as the Boeing 787-10 was approaching Shanghai, the cabin crew intervened and asked the passenger to hand over his cigarettes and lighter.

After the aircraft landed at Shanghai Pudong International Airport, authorities boarded the aircraft and took the passenger away for questioning. Singapore Airlines reiterated that smoking, vaping, and the use of similar products are prohibited on its flights, adding that passengers caught smoking or vaping onboard will be banned from travelling on both Singapore Airlines and Scoot.
